Ag@SiO2 Core-Shell Nanoparticles: Synthesis and Applications

Ag@SiO2 core-shell nanoparticles have emerged as efficient materials for a wide range of applications. These nanoparticles consist of a metallic silver core enveloped by a silica shell, offering unique properties that stem from the synergistic interaction between these two components.
